Why Do You Need a Root Canal Treatment?
A root canal procedure is necessary when the pulp inside the tooth becomes inflamed or infected due to deep decay, cracks, trauma or repeated dental treatments. If left untreated, the infection can spread, leading to severe pain, abscess formation and even tooth loss. Root canal therapy eliminates the infection while preserving the tooth structure.
Signs You May Need a Root Canal Procedure
Persistent toothache or pain when chewing
Sensitivity to hot or cold that lingers
Swollen or tender gums around a specific tooth
Darkening or discoloration of the tooth
Presence of pus or an abscess near the tooth

Step-by-Step Process of a Root Canal Treatment
At Sukumar Dental Clinic, we ensure a pain-free root canal procedure with advanced technology and gentle care. Here’s what to expect:
1. Diagnosis & X-Ray Evaluation
Our dentist will examine your tooth and take digital X-rays to assess the extent of the infection and determine if root canal therapy is required.
2. Local Anesthesia for Pain-Free Treatment
Before starting the procedure, we administer local anesthesia to ensure complete comfort. Modern techniques make the procedure virtually painless.
3. Removing the Infected Pulp
Using specialized instruments, we carefully remove the infected pulp and clean the inside of the tooth, eliminating bacteria and preventing further infection.
4. Disinfection & Shaping the Root Canals
The root canals are thoroughly disinfected and shaped to prepare for filling. This step ensures the complete removal of harmful bacteria.
5. Filling & Sealing the Canals
After cleaning, the canals are filled with a biocompatible material called gutta-percha, which prevents reinfection. The tooth is then sealed with a temporary or permanent filling.
6. Restoration with a Dental Crown
In most cases, a dental crown is recommended after root canal therapy to strengthen the tooth and restore its function. Our clinic offers high-quality, natural-looking crowns for lasting protection.

Aftercare Tips for a Successful Root Canal Recovery
Avoid chewing on the treated tooth until the final restoration is placed.
Maintain excellent oral hygiene with regular brushing and flossing.
Follow any prescribed medications to reduce swelling or discomfort.
Attend follow-up visits to ensure proper healing.
Get a permanent dental crown to enhance the strength of the treated tooth.
Debunking Common Myths About Root Canal Therapy
Myth 1: Root Canals Are Painful
Fact: With modern anesthesia and advanced techniques, root canal treatment is virtually pain-free. Most patients compare it to a routine filling.
Myth 2: Extraction Is a Better Option
Fact: Saving your natural tooth through root canal therapy is always preferable to extraction, as it maintains natural function and aesthetics.
Myth 3: Root Canals Require Multiple Appointments
Fact: Most root canal procedures are completed in one or two visits, depending on the complexity of the case.
Myth 4: Root Canals Cause Illness
Fact: There is no scientific evidence linking root canal therapy to any health issues. The procedure eliminates infection and promotes oral well-being.

Q: Is Root Canal Treatment Painful?
A: No, modern root canal treatment is not painful. With the use of local anesthesia and advanced techniques, the procedure is virtually painless. Most patients feel relief from the pain they had before treatment rather than experiencing discomfort.
Q: How Long Does a Root Canal Procedure Take?
A: A root canal procedure usually takes one to two visits. The duration depends on the severity of the infection and the complexity of the tooth structure. Each session may last between 60 to 90 minutes, ensuring complete disinfection and restoration.
Q: What Happens If I Delay a Root Canal Treatment?
A: Delaying root canal therapy can lead to severe pain, abscess formation, and the spread of infection to surrounding teeth and gums. In some cases, it may lead to tooth loss, requiring more complex and expensive dental procedures to restore function.
Q: How Long Will the Treated Tooth Last After a Root Canal?
A: A successfully treated tooth with a root canal procedure can last a lifetime with proper care. Regular brushing, flossing, and routine dental checkups will help maintain its health and function. A crown is often recommended for long-term durability.
Q: Can I Eat Normally After a Root Canal?
A: After root canal treatment, it is advisable to avoid hard or sticky foods until the final restoration is placed. Once the permanent filling or crown is in place, you can eat normally, but maintaining good oral hygiene is essential to prolong the tooth’s lifespan.
